THE SCARLET LETTER
ADAPTED BY PHYLLIS NAGY FROM THE NOVEL BY NATHANIEL HAWTHORNE
DIRECTED BY TANYA FEDUIK-SMITH
This is not your English teacher’s The Scarlet Letter.
Set in Puritan-era Boston, this brilliant, unique adaptation of the classic novel has a decidedly contemporary slant. While preserving the familiar story of Hester Prynne, Roger Chillingworth and Arthur Dimmesdale, the manner in which it addresses the tale is almost a feminist deconstruction of this American Literary Classic.
As told from the now adult Pearl’s perspective, Hester’s story answers the question: do the Puritanical labels others thrust upon us have power over us if we refuse to embrace their scorn?

Set in Purgatory (which closely resembles the New York subway), this comic courtroom drama uses biblical and historical figures as witnesses for the case of: God and the Kingdom of Heaven and Earth v. Judas Iscariot. As they try to decide who was responsible for Jesus’s death.
One of the oldest tales of betrayal and forgiveness, it shines a humorous light on our own ‘heavens’, ‘hells’ and ‘purgatories’ In the end, we are our own judges, juries and – in some cases – executioners.
